  22. I don't work directly with debian or altirra, but I do use vulkan/vkd3d/wine a lot. For directx12 in wine, you need vulkan/vkd3d. In vanilla wine, directx9,10,11 go through opengl. You can make dx9,dx10,dx11 use vulkan by using winetricks dxvk. World of Warcraft can use dx11 or dx12. If I play that in dx11 mode without "winetricks dxvk" I will get a low frame rate, but after winetricks dxvk the framerate will sky-rocket. Not sure if anything here will help, just my experiences, might be inaccurate now. There are added complexities such as proton's version of vkd3d and managing specific versions of wine and other things. lutris and steam are good for these situations and might have specific install scripts for certain applications/games. For example, for Diablo IV, most people will just use the lutris install script to get it to "just work."
